17 hours ago, Phini Lite said:

Also my current build is a Cooler Master Cosmos C700M ATX Full Tower Case, Asus ROG STRIX Z690-F GAMING WIFI ATX LGA1700 Motherboard, Intel Core i9-12900K 3.2 GHz 16-Core Processor, Corsair iCUE H150i ELITE LCD XT 65.57 CFM Liquid CPU Cooler, Kingston FURY Beast RGB 64 GB (2 x 32 GB) DDR5-6400 CL32 Memory, Asus, STRIX GAMING OC GeForce RTX 3080 10GB 10 GB Video Card, Asus ROG THOR 1200P 1200 W 80+ Platinum Certified Fully Modular ATX Power Supply, Samsung 990 Pro 2 TB M.2-2280 PCIe 4.0 X4 NVME Solid State Drive. I would also like to know what I can do to upgrade this one for the same things as well, if possible!?

that board can support 14th gen Intel, so that is an option

https://rog.asus.com/us/motherboards/rog-strix/rog-strix-z690-f-gaming-wifi-model/helpdesk_qvl_cpu/

and the GPU could be upgraded, but honestly everything else should be fine.

so if you only wanted to upgrade components it's feasible. 

Maybe increase RAM depending on the needs of the software your running. "personal AI" could use megabytes or terabytes depending.
